Job Description



Job Purpose



  • To provide support in the various accounting functions which include correcting, processing, analyzing and reconciling a wide variety of accounting documents such as invoices, departmental billings, employee reimbursements, cash receipts, vendor statements.


Duties and Responsibilities



  • Verification of calculations and input of codes into the accounting system in an accurate manner;

  • Posting ofcash receipts and payment vouchers into the cashbook;

  • Ensuring all respective support documents such as receipts are attached to payment vouchers;

  • Monthly preparation of bank reconciliations;

  • Compilation, analysis and preparation of data for financial statements, expenditures, revenues, accounts and reports;

  • Assist in the preparation of budgets and provision of updates on budget implementation;

  • Assist in monitoring the expenditures to ensure that funds are utilized appropriately by the close of the fiscal year.

  • Participation in the preparations for external, internal and tax audit exercises;

  • Ensuring all relevant files and documents are readily available for smooth running of audit exercises;

  • Performing any other duties asrequired;


Key Performance Indicators



  • Ability to reconcile and or balance financial transactions and accounts.

  • Knowledge of accounting and book-keeping terminology and practices.

  • Knowledge of general record keeping and filing systems.

  • Ability to compare data from a variety of sources for accuracy and completeness.

  • Ability to detect errors.

  • Ability to determine work priorities


Working conditions



  • Work is primarily done in a business/office environment

  • Limited travel.


Qualifications



  • Bachelor's Degree in Accounting or related field

  • Must have 3-5 years of progressive experience in finance or accounting for a structured organization (previous oil & gas experience is compulsory)

  • A certified member of Institute of Chartered Accountants of Nigeria (ICAN)/ACCA.

  • Knowledge of applicable accounting and financial reporting rules, regulations and requirements

  • Strong analytical skills – understanding of revenue – cost structures andtranslatedata to clear analytics

  • Strong Microsoft Office skills (Excel and PowerPoint); experience with financial modeling a plus
